What is the current status of the Supreme Court hearing on the abrogation of Article 370
The Supreme Court hearing on the abrogation of Article 370 has been ongoing. Can you provide an update on the current status of the hearing?
- The Supreme Court is currently hearing multiple petitions challenging the abrogation of Article 370 of the Indian Constitution.
- The petitions argue that the abrogation was unconstitutional as it was done without the approval of the Jammu and Kashmir state legislature.
- The Court initially heard arguments on the constitutionality of the abrogation, focusing on whether it required the consent of the state legislature or not.
- Several parties, including the Central government, have argued that the President has the power to make changes to Jammu and Kashmir's special status under the Constitution.
- The Court has also been examining the impact and consequences of the abrogation on the rights of the people of Jammu and Kashmir.
- The hearings have included the consideration of issues such as the restoration of internet services, the detention of individuals, and the overall security situation in the region.
- The Court has sought responses from the government on various aspects related to the abrogation and has adjourned the case to allow for further arguments.
